Dienstintegration – Ad Hoc Add-in
- Last Updated: November 21, 2024
- 7 minute read
- MOVEit Transfer
- Version 2024.1
- Version 2024
- Documentation
Anforderungen für den Microsoft Mail-Server
Das MOVEit Transfer Add-in basiert auf der webbasierten Add-in-Architektur von Microsoft. Um es für Ihr Unternehmen nutzen zu können, muss Ihre Microsoft Mail-Lösung die Mindestanforderungen für webbasierte Add-ins erfüllen und die Microsoft API-Funktionen unterstützen, die für unsere Add-in-Funktionalität erforderlich sind
Microsoft 365-Abonnement
Outlook-Clients, die mit Microsoft 365 verbunden sind (mindestens Version 2008, Build 13127.20296).
Exchange Online
Wenn Ihre Organisation nicht Microsoft 365 verwendet, funktioniert das Add-in auch mit Exchange Online und den folgenden Outlook-Clients:
- Unbegrenztes Outlook 2016 oder höher für Endkunden.
- Volumenlizenz Outlook 2021 für unbegrenzte Zeit.
Integrationsanforderungen für MOVEit Transfer Server
Vor der Bereitstellung bzw. Konfiguration von Outlook oder Exchange müssen die in diesem Abschnitt aufgeführten Konfigurationseinstellungen von MOVEit Transfer Server vorgenommen werden.
| Anforderung... | Vorgehensweise... |
|---|---|
| Ad Hoc Transfer-Lizenz für Produktionsumgebungen |
|
| Ad Hoc Transfer ist in der Web-Benutzeroberfläche aktiviert. | Weitere Informationen finden Sie unter „Einstellungen für Benutzeroberfläche ändern“. (Hierbei handelt es sich um eine organisationsweite Einstellung.) |
| Bei mindestens einem Benutzer muss Ad Hoc Transfer aktiviert sein. | Weitere Informationen finden Sie im Abschnitt „Ad Hoc Transfer für ausgewählte Organisationen aktivieren“. |
| Cross Origin Resource Sharing (CORS) ist aktiviert. |
Fügen Sie auf der Registerkarte Settings (Einstellungen) im Konfigurationsprogramm von MOVEit Transfer einen CORS-Eintrag hinzu, so dass auf die Add-in-Komponenten zugegriffen werden kann: Best Practice: Geben Sie einen benutzerdefinierten Wert für den gehosteten Add-in-Ordner an. Derzeit wird er hier gehostet: https://moveit.addins.progress.com Anmerkung: Minimum: Einstellung Basic (Einfach) muss aktiviert sein
|
|
Benutzern die Kopplung der Authentifizierung mit Outlook ermöglichen (optional) (Aktiviert die Option „Anmeldeinformationen speichern“ für Outlook-Benutzer. Damit kann das MOVEit Transfer Ad Hoc Add-in verwendet werden, ohne dass sich Benutzer jedes Mal bei MOVEit Transfer anmelden müssen, wenn Outlook geöffnet wird.) |
Weitere Informationen finden Sie unter „Sicherheits-Token für externe Anwendungen konfigurieren“. Sie können diese Einstellung hier überprüfen: WebUI SETTINGS > Security Policies – User Auth – Trusted Applications (EINSTELLUNGEN > Sicherheitsrichtlinien – Benutzerauthentifizierung – Vertrauenswürdige Anwendungen) |
| Vorlaufzeit von ca. einem halben Tag einplanen. | Nach der Bereitstellung in den O365-Umgebungen der Benutzer kann es bis zu ca. 12 Stunden oder einen Tag dauern (in der Regel jedoch weniger lang), bis die Add-ins in der Produktionsumgebung gepusht wurden (und das Add-in in den zentral verwalteten Outlook-Clients angezeigt wird). |
Wenn die in der Tabelle aufgeführten Anforderungen für MOVEit Transfer erfüllt wurden, können Sie das MOVEit Transfer Ad Hoc Add-in für Benutzer mit den Cloud- bzw. Enterprise-Werkzeugen von Microsoft bereitstellen.
Ad Hoc mit Microsoft 365 Admin Center zentral bereitstellen und verwalten
Standorte mit Exchange-Online-Postfächern können die zentrale Bereitstellung für Add-ins von Microsoft nutzen.
Das Ad Hoc Outlook-Add-in kann den meisten Gruppen zugewiesen werden, die von Azure Active Directory unterstützt werden, z. B.:
- Microsoft 365-Gruppen
- Verteilerlisten
- Sicherheitsgruppen
Vorbereitung der Bereitstellung
Prüfen Sie vor der Bereitstellung des MOVEit Transfer Ad Hoc Add-ins for Outlook in der Umgebung Ihrer Benutzer die Anforderungen in der Tabelle unten:
| Anforderung... | Vorgehensweise... |
|---|---|
| Administrator-Berechtigungen für O365 | Melden Sie sich entweder als globaler Administrator oder als Exchange-Administrator bei Exchange an. |
| Benutzer in der Organisation haben Konten, bei denen eine App-Registrierung zulässig ist. | Die Eigenschaft App-Registrierungen in den Benutzereinstellungen im Azure Active Directory Admin Center muss auf Ja gestellt sein. |
Bereitstellung mit Admin Center
Sie finden das Microsoft 365 Admin Center unter https://admin.microsoft.com. Sie benötigen Administratorberechtigungen für Microsoft 365. Details erhalten Sie beim Microsoft-Administrator.
Microsoft Admin Center (Seite „Integrierte Apps“)

- Klicken Sie im Microsoft 365 Admin Center auf Einstellungen > Integrierte Apps.
Die Seite „Start – Integrierte Apps“ wird angezeigt.
- Klicken Sie auf den Hyperlink Add-ins.
Die Seite „Add-ins“ wird angezeigt.
- Klicken Sie auf Add-in bereitstellen.

„Neues Add-in bereitstellen“ wird angezeigt.
- Klicken Sie im unteren Bereich des Bereitstellungsfensters auf Weiter.

- Benutzerdefinierte Apps hochladen. Laden Sie das Add-in mit der MOVEit-Manifest-Datei hoch. (https://moveit.addins.progress.com/transfer/outlook/manifest.xml)
Das Fenster Add-in konfigurieren wird angezeigt.
- Wählen Sie eine Option im Abschnitt „Benutzer zuweisen“ aus:
- Alle
- Bestimmte Benutzer/Gruppen
- Nur ich
- Wählen Sie unter „Bereitstellungsmethode“ einen Modus aus:
- Fest (Standard) Das Add-in wird automatisch zugewiesenen Benutzern bereitgestellt.
- Verfügbar. Das Add-in steht zur Bereitstellung zur Verfügung (wird jedoch nicht auf dem Outlook-Band der Benutzer installiert).
- Optional. Das Add-in wird bereitgestellt und im Outlook-Client des Benutzers angezeigt, aber der Benutzer kann es entfernen.
- Klicken Sie auf „Bereitstellen“.
Bereitstellung mit Cmdlets (PowerShell)
Wenn Sie die Bereitstellung und Konfiguration des MOVEit Transfer Add-ins programmatisch verwalten möchten, können Sie Windows PowerShell mit dem zentralisierten Add-in-Modul von O365 (O365CentralizedAddInDeployment) kombinieren.
- Verweisen Sie auf die Bibliothek, die O365-Admin-Methoden zur Verfügung stellt.
Beispiel:
Import-Module -Name O365CentralizedAddInDeployment
- Erstellen Sie eine Management-Sitzung.
Connect-OrganizationAddInService
- Geben Sie die Anmeldeinformationen an. (Wenn Sie diese nicht als PowerShell-Eigenschaften angeben, fragt Windows sie interaktiv ab.)
Beispiel – erstellen Sie eine Anmeldeinformationen-Eigenschaft:
$secpasswd = ConvertTo-SecureString "MaiKewlUneeqPasswd" -AsPlainText -Force
– Ersetzen Sie hier MaiKewlUneeqPasswd mit Ihren Kennwort.
– und erstellen Sie ein Anmeldeinformationen-Objekt, indem die Anmeldeinformationen-Eigenschaft (secpasswd) als Eingangsargument für die Methode verwendet wird, die ein Anmeldeinformationen-Objekt (mycredentials) erstellt. Beispiel:
$mycredentials = New-Object System.Management.Automation.PSCredential ("myMsftAdmin@example.com", $secpasswd)
- Stellen Sie eine Verbindung mit O365 her.
Beispiel:
Connect-OrganizationAddInService -Credential $mycredentials
- Laden Sie das Add-in mit der Manifest-Datei hoch.
Beispiel:
New-OrganizationAddIn -ManifestPath 'https://moveit.addins.progress.com/transfer/outlook/manifest.xml' -Locale 'en-US' -Members 'myExampleUser@example.com'
– Hier ist
Status des Add-ins abrufen (Admin Center)https://moveit.addins.progress.com/transfer/outlook/manifest.xmldie URL der gehosteten Manifest-Datei.Sie können den Status des MOVEit Transfer Ad Hoc Add-ins for Outlook hier abrufen:
- Spalte Status auf der Seite Start > Integrierte Apps.
- Spalte Status auf der Add-ins-Seite (Home > Add-ins)
- Umschalter Status für ein konkretes Add-in (Start > Add-ins [MOVEit Add Hoc Add-in]
Start > Integrierte Apps – Spalte „Status“ (O365 Admin Center)
Vollständige Details und Status des Add-ins abrufen (einzeiliges PowerShell-Skript)
Umfassende Details zum MOVEit Transfer Outlook-Add-in für Ihre Organisation und deren Status können Sie mit folgendem einzeiligen PowerShell-Skript abrufen:
$Get-OrganizationAddIn -ProductId 05c2e1c9-3e1d-406e-9a91-e9ac64854143 | Format-List
– Hier ist
05c2e1c9-3e1d-406e-9a91-e9ac64854143die aktuelle Produkt-ID für das MOVEit Transfer Ad Hoc Add-in.
Add-in anpassen
Sie können Text und Symbole, die im Add-in verwendet werden, anpassen, indem Sie die XML-Manifest-Datei bearbeiten und das Add-in aus Ihrer angepassten Kopie verwenden (mit der Option Aus Datei hochladen). Sie müssen Ihre kuratierte/angepasste Kopie hochladen und nicht über die Progress-CDN-URL.
Diese Anpassungsfunktion gibt Ihnen die Kontrolle über:
- Textzeichenfolgen und Operationen (Schaltflächen), wie MOVEit Add in der Outlook-Benutzeroberfläche angezeigt wird.
- Auf diesen Schaltflächen angezeigte Icons.
- Standard-MOVEit-Serveradresse.
- Und so weiter.
Outlook Add-in Manifest-Datei

Genauere Angaben zur Anpassung finden Sie unten. Zunächst ein Überblick über die grundlegenden Schritte:
- Navigieren Sie in einem Webbrowser zu der Online-Manifest-Datei (manifest.xml).
- Speichern Sie die XML-Manifest-Datei auf einem Computer, damit sie bearbeitet werden kann. Wichtig: Bewahren Sie eine Kopie der ursprünglichen Datei auf. Dies ist hilfreich, wenn Sie das Gefühl haben, einen früheren Zustand vergleichen oder wiederherstellen zu müssen.Tipp: Wenn Sie die XML-Datei anpassen, ist es ratsam, die ursprüngliche Progress-CDN-gestufte XML-Datei im Auge zu behalten (um sie auf Aktualisierungen zu überwachen). Sie können auch die Versionshinweise überprüfen, falls Sie sich entscheiden, Aktualisierungen mit Ihrer eigenen lokalen Kopie zusammenzuführen. (Sie können z. B. die Dateiüberwachungsfunktion von WhatsUp Gold oder eine Anwendung verwenden, die Etags überprüft)
- Nehmen Sie im Abschnitt „Resources“ der XML-Manifest-Datei in den Bereichen „Images“, „ShortStrings“ und „LongStrings“ die gewünschten Änderungen vor.
- Speichern Sie die Datei. Tipp: Stellen Sie beim Speichern sicher, dass Sie einen Editor verwenden, der die ursprüngliche Zeichenkodierung beibehält, z. B. Visual Studio Editor oder Notepad++. Ignorieren Sie die Warnungen zur Zeichenkodierung nicht. (Die Manifest-Datei enthält lokalisierte Zeichenfolgen)
- Stellen Sie das Add-in mit der angepassten XML-Manifest-Datei über die Option Aus Datei hochladen (statt Von URL hochladen) bereit.
Manifest-Datei anpassen
- Speichern Sie eine Kopie der XML-Manifest-Datei auf dem Computer und öffnen Sie sie zur Bearbeitung:
- Öffnen Sie die Progress-URL zur XML-Manifest-Datei in einem Webbrowser (https://moveit.addins.progress.com/transfer/outlook/manifest.xml).
- Klicken Sie mit der rechten Maustaste in das Browser-Fenster und speichern Sie die Datei mit „Speichern unter“ auf dem Computer.
- Öffnen Sie die Datei in einem Text-Editor und gehen Sie zum Abschnitt „Resources“ am Ende der Datei.
- Bearbeiten Sie „Images“, „ShortStrings“ und „LongStrings“. Sie können sogar eine Standard-MOVEit-Serveradresse angeben, um Ihre Anpassungen zu berücksichtigen.
Images-Attribut
Im Bereich „Images“ befinden sich die von Progress gehosteten Speicherorte (URLS) für die einzelnen Symbolgrößen. Wenn Sie eigene Symbole verwenden möchten, benötigen Sie Bilder für jede unten aufgeführte Größe an einem öffentlich zugänglichen Speicherort. Ersetzen Sie dann die von Progress gehostete Bild-URL mit der eigenen Bild-URL für die einzelnen Größen.
<bt:Images>
<bt:Image id="Icon.16x16"
DefaultValue="https://moveit.addins.progress.com/transfer/outlook/assets/icon-16.png"/>
<bt:Image id="Icon.32x32"
DefaultValue="https://moveit.addins.progress.com/transfer/outlook/assets/icon-32.png"/>
<bt:Image id="Icon.64x64"
DefaultValue="https://moveit.addins.progress.com/transfer/outlook/assets/icon-64.png"/>
<bt:Image id="Icon.80x80"
DefaultValue="https://moveit.addins.progress.com/transfer/outlook/assets/icon-80.png"/>
</bt:Images>
ShortStrings- und LongStrings-Attribute
Im Bereich „ShortStrings“ und „LongStrings“ sind die Texte auf den Befehlsschaltflächen und für QuickInfos enthalten. Bearbeiten Sie „DefaultValue“ für die einzelnen Texte, um den Text zu ändern, der für die einzelnen Elemente angezeigt wird. Die Bedeutung der einzelnen Zeichenfolgen ist ziemlich offensichtlich, aber um zu verstehen, wo die einzelnen Zeichenfolgen in Outlook verwendet werden, kann es hilfreich sein, das Add-in zunächst im Originalzustand zu installieren und dann Ihre Änderungen vorzunehmen.
<bt:ShortStrings>
<bt:String id="ComposeGroupLabel" DefaultValue="MOVEit Transfer"/>
<bt:String id="TaskpaneButton.Label" DefaultValue="Create Secure Package"/>
<bt:String id="ReadGroupLabel" DefaultValue="MOVEit Transfer"/>
<bt:String id="ReadDialogButton.Label" DefaultValue="View Secure Package"/>
</bt:ShortStrings>
<bt:LongStrings>
<bt:String id="TaskpaneButton.Tooltip" DefaultValue="Create and send files and
messages securely using MOVEit Transfer"/>
<bt:String id="ReadDialogButton.Tooltip" DefaultValue="View the secure package
associated with a 'New Package' notification"/>
</bt:LongStrings>
Hinzufügen einer benutzerdefinierten MOVEit Transfer-Serveradresse
Sie können eine Standardadresse für den MOVEit Transfer-Server für alle Benutzer des MOVEit-Add-ins für Microsoft Outlook festlegen. Die Benutzer können diese Standardadresse verwenden, überschreiben und zu ihr zurückkehren, wenn Sie sie in der Manifest-Datei angeben.
<Resources>
<bt:Images>
<bt:Image id="Icon.16x16" DefaultValue="https://localhost:3000/assets/icon-16.png"/>
<bt:Image id="Icon.32x32" DefaultValue="https://localhost:3000/assets/icon-32.png"/>
<bt:Image id="Icon.64x64" DefaultValue="https://localhost:3000/assets/icon-64.png"/>
<bt:Image id="Icon.80x80" DefaultValue="https://localhost:3000/assets/icon-80.png"/>
</bt:Images>
<bt:Urls>
<bt:Url id="Commands.Url" DefaultValue="https://localhost:3000/commands.html" />
<bt:Url id="Taskpane.Url" DefaultValue="https://localhost:3000/taskpane.html?DefaultMitServerAddress=" />
</bt:Urls>
Beispiel
<bt:Url id="Taskpane.Url" DefaultValue="https://localhost:3000/taskpane.html?DefaultMitServerAddress=moveit.beispiel.de"/>
Add-in mit Änderungen bereitstellen
Stellen Sie als Best Practice das Add-in einem Test-Benutzer bereit, um zu prüfen, dass die Änderungen Ihren Wünschen entsprechen (über den Befehl „Add-ins abrufen“ in der Outlook-Symbolleiste). Sobald Sie die Änderungen zufriedenstellend geprüft haben, stellen Sie das Add-in an alle übrigen Benutzer bereit. Nutzen Sie dazu die oben aufgeführten Schritte, aber verwenden Sie die angepasste Manifest-Datei statt der Progress-CDN-URL für die Standard-Manifest-Datei.
Lokalisierte Versionen aktualisieren
Der Anwendungscode für das Add-in wird automatisch anhand des Gebietsschemas (Anzeigesprache) der in Outlook eingestellten Sprache angezeigt.
Es ist jedoch nicht der gesamte lokalisierte Text in das Add-in eingebettet.
Das sog. Manifest stellt lokalisierten Text in der Outlook-Benutzeroberfläche (z. B. Beschreibung des Add-ins und Infos zur Anwendung) bereit. Wenn Sie ein Upgrade auf eine Version vornehmen, die erst kürzlich lokalisiert wurde, und Text in der Benutzeroberfläche von Outlook auf Englisch angezeigt wird, muss das Manifest neu geladen werden.
Aktualisierung des Manifests für die Outlook-Benutzeroberfläche zur Lokalisierung
